Hodgson explains Oxlade-Chamberlain selection

Roy Hodgson has challenged Alex Oxlade-Chamberlain to play his way into the team for England's opening game of Euro 2012 against France in nine days time.

The young Arsenal midfielder has been handed a role in the starting lineup for this afternoon's friendly encounter Belgium at Wembley.

Discussing Oxlade-Chamberlain's presence in the team, Hodgson told ITV Sport: "He is in the squad, he's done well in training and it's important to get a look at him.

"It's a big ask of him today but, if we don't give him the opportunity, we'll be wondering how he can cope in the tournament.

"It's not make or break but it'll be nice if he can go on and show what a quality footballer he is."

The 18-year-old made his senior debut against Norway last week.
